Brake Put in Hot Seat by Collingwood School Pupils

6.47.26pm GMT Tue 2nd Dec 2008

Tom Brake, MP for Carshalton and Wallington, was the guest of Collingwood School Year 6 pupils last Friday morning.

In a lively Question and Answer session, Tom was questioned about why he chose to became an MP (because he was wanted to do something about the environment), what he didn't like about the job (the number of emails!) and whether he had met the Queen (twice very briefly).

Tom said after the event, "I always find Q+As with school pupils very refreshing. They always want to talk about real things, not the political scandal of the day! Collingwood pupils were no exception, their questions were pertinent and pointed."

Year 6 pupils are likely to have a further opportunity to put Mr Brake on the spot during a future visit to Parliament.

Collingwood School is an independent school in Springfield Road in Wallington.
